Nutrition Tips to Support Your Resistance Training
Effective resistance training requires proper nutritional support to maximize results and promote recovery. Protein intake becomes particularly important, with recommendations typically ranging from 1.6 to 2.2 grams per kilogram of body weight for individuals engaged in regular strength training. Quality protein sources include lean meats, fish, legumes, eggs, and dairy products.
Carbohydrates fuel your training sessions and replenish glycogen stores depleted during exercise. Complex carbohydrates from whole grains, vegetables, and fruits provide sustained energy while delivering essential micronutrients. Healthy fats from sources like olive oil, nuts, avocados, and fatty fish support hormone production and reduce inflammation, both critical for muscle recovery and growth.
Hydration deserves equal attention in any fitness protocol. Adequate fluid intake before, during, and after training sessions maintains performance and facilitates nutrient transport to working muscles. Water remains the primary choice, though electrolyte-enhanced beverages may benefit those engaging in extended or particularly intense training sessions.
Wellness Strategies for Sustainable Training Progress
Sustainable fitness progress requires more than physical effort alone. Comprehensive wellness strategies incorporate rest, recovery, and progressive overload principles. Resistance training protocols using terracotta weights should follow structured progression, gradually increasing resistance, volume, or exercise complexity as adaptation occurs.
Rest days allow muscular repair and neurological recovery, preventing overtraining syndrome and reducing injury risk. Most evidence-based protocols recommend training each muscle group two to three times weekly, with at least 48 hours between sessions targeting the same muscle groups. This approach optimizes protein synthesis while preventing excessive fatigue accumulation.
Variety in exercise selection prevents both physical plateaus and mental burnout. Terracotta weights accommodate numerous movement patterns, including presses, rows, curls, extensions, and compound movements. Rotating exercises every four to six weeks maintains training stimulus while reducing repetitive stress on joints and connective tissues.
Preventive Healthcare Through Regular Strength Training
Resistance training delivers profound preventive healthcare benefits extending throughout the lifespan. Regular strength training increases bone mineral density, reducing osteoporosis risk particularly significant for aging populations. Studies consistently demonstrate that progressive resistance exercise stimulates bone formation and slows age-related bone loss.
Metabolic health improvements represent another crucial benefit. Muscle tissue maintains higher metabolic activity than adipose tissue, meaning increased muscle mass elevates resting energy expenditure. This metabolic advantage supports weight management and improves insulin sensitivity, reducing type 2 diabetes risk. Additionally, resistance training positively influences cardiovascular health markers, including blood pressure, cholesterol profiles, and arterial function.
Functional capacity preservation ensures independence and quality of life as individuals age. Strength training maintains the physical capabilities necessary for daily activities, from carrying groceries to climbing stairs. This functional preservation reduces fall risk and supports continued participation in recreational activities and social engagement.

Practical Implementation and Safety Considerations
Implementing terracotta weight protocols requires attention to proper technique and safety principles. Begin with lighter implements to master movement patterns before progressing to heavier resistance. Quality instruction, whether through certified trainers, reputable online resources, or instructional materials, ensures proper form and reduces injury risk.
Warm-up routines prepare the body for training demands, increasing tissue temperature and joint mobility. Five to ten minutes of light cardiovascular activity followed by dynamic stretching optimizes performance and safety. Similarly, cool-down periods facilitate recovery and reduce post-exercise muscle soreness.
Listening to your body remains paramount throughout any training protocol. Distinguish between productive training discomfort and pain signaling potential injury. Sharp pain, joint discomfort, or symptoms persisting beyond normal post-exercise soreness warrant professional evaluation. Modifying exercises to accommodate individual limitations or pre-existing conditions ensures safe, sustainable participation.
